In order to deal with various imprecise opinions and preferences of decision makers in group decision-making process, this paper proposes a fuzzy group decision-making approach. The approach has three advantages from existing approaches. First, it can handle simultaneously group members’ fuzzy preferences for alternative solutions, fuzzy judgments for solution selection criteria and fuzzy weights for their roles in group decision-making to arrive a group consensus decision. Second, it allows group members to generate selection criteria for the best solution rather than assume them to be given before a group meeting. The third is that it uses general fuzzy number to express linguistic terms which is used to describe the fuzziness of individual preferences, judgments and weights in group decision-making. It therefore accepts any forms of fuzzy number, including triangular fuzzy number, rectangle fuzzy number and continuous fuzzy number, when applying the group decision-making approach.